IBM® Application Discovery and Delivery Intelligence (ADDI) serves as a powerful analytical tool designed for the modernization of applications. By leveraging cognitive technologies, it efficiently analyzes mainframe applications, enabling users to swiftly uncover and comprehend the interdependencies associated with modifications. This rapid enhancement of mainframe applications can significantly contribute to revenue generation and facilitate quicker returns on investments. Moreover, by improving your understanding of application complexity, ADDI helps you foresee potential issues, thereby reducing application and development costs. The platform allows for the agile evolution of systems and applications, maximizing the benefits of hybrid cloud environments. With enhanced application insights, organizations can boost productivity while minimizing risks, effectively accelerating their digital transformation journey. Furthermore, the platform's rapid analysis capabilities enable users to identify relationships among various components of IBM z/OS® applications, providing clarity on the potential impact of changes. Users can quickly locate essential business rules, code snippets, and APIs, empowering them to optimize their business processes and foster innovation. With ADDI, organizations can confidently navigate their modernization efforts and embrace the future of technology.
